ABSTRACT

OBJECTIVE:

Describe the utility of circulating tumor DNA in the post-operative surveillance of hepatocellular carcinoma (HCC). SUMMARY BACKGROUND DATA Current biomarkers for HCC like Alpha-fetoprotein (AFP) are lacking. ctDNA has shown promise in colorectal and lung cancers, but its utility in HCC remains relatively unknown.

METHODS:

Patients with HCC undergoing curative-intent resection from 11/1/2020-7/1/2023 received ctDNA testing using the Guardant360 platform. TMB is calculated as the number of somatic mutations-per-megabase of genomic material identified.

RESULTS:

Forty seven patients had post-operative ctDNA testing. Mean follow-up was 27 months and maximum was 43.2 months. Twelve patients (26%) experienced recurrence. Most (n=41/47, 87.2%) had identifiable ctDNA post-operatively; 55.3%(n=26) were TMB-not detected versus 45.7% (n=21) TMB-detectable. Post-operative identifiable ctDNA was not associated with RFS (P=0.518). Detectable TMB was associated with reduced RFS (6.9 vs. 14.7months, P=0.049). There was a higher rate of recurrence in patients with TMB (n=9/21, 42.9%, vs. n=3/26, 11.5%, P=0.02). Area-Under the Curve (AUC) for TMB-prediction of recurrence was 0.752 versus 0.550 for AFP. ROC-analysis established a TMB cut-off of 4.8mut/mB for predicting post-operative recurrence (P=0.002) and RFS (P=0.025). AFP was not correlated with RFS using the lab-normal cut-off (<11 ng/mL, P=0.682) or the cut-off established by ROC-analysis (>4.6 ng/mL, P=0.494). TMB-high was associated with poorer RFS on cox-regression analysis (HR=5.386, 95%CI1.109-26.160, P=0.037) while micro-vascular invasion (P=0.853) and AFP (P=0.439) were not.

CONCLUSIONS:

Identifiable TMB on post-operative ctDNA predicts HCC recurrence, and outperformed AFP in this cohort. Perioperative ctDNA may be a useful surveillance tool following curative-intent hepatectomy. Larger-scale studies are needed to confirm this utility and investigate additional applications in HCC patients, including the potential for prophylactic treatment in patients with residual TMB after resection.
